I have a tree, that I randomly call the Tulip Tree. It is just starting to bloom tulip like flowers that are approximately 4-6″ long (the petals). The flowers are upright. The tree itself is at most 10′ high and about 15′ wide. I am not certain (why I am asking you to help) but I do not believe it is the Liriodendrum tulipifera tree (by virtue of its height/age and foliage). But, I could be quite wrong. Appreciate the guidance here. Magnolia! Thanks to all of you that provided the details. I have a Magnolia Tree (‘magnolia-x-soulangeana-family-magnoliaceae’)
